A popular Isle of Wight attraction has paid tribute to its beloved goat Jar Jar after the difficult decision was made to say goodbye.

Tapnell Farm Park, near Freshwater, announced ‘with great sadness’ yesterday (Friday) that its Anglo Nubian Goat, Jar Jar, had passed away.

Jar Jar was well-known for his large floppy ears and noisy presence at the West Wight attraction since 2016.

After a long better of ill health and loss of condition, the Tapnell keepers decided it was time to say goodbye.

Tapnell posted on the Facebook page: “He was a gentle giant and was very much loved by his keepers and visitors.

“He will be greatly missed by everyone here at the Farm Park and by his best bud Britt.”
